Merge pull request #79935 from dalexeev/gds-validate-node-path-annotation

GDScript: Add validation for `@export_node_path` annotation arguments

 				[codeblock]
 				@export_node_path("Button", "TouchScreenButton") var some_button
 				[/codeblock]
+				[b]Note:[/b] The type must be a native class or a globally registered script (using the [code]class_name[/code] keyword) that inherits [Node].
